I was sitting on the banks of the Ganges River attempting to meditate when a swami approached me and asked “What do I know?” I told him “I know nothing.”

He smiled and said follow me. The following is a night I will never forget. – The Ganges River is the mother of India, yet she is endangered by pollution. Meet Swamiji Muni Baba and other great Indian minds who refuse to let her die.
